CVE-2024-56313: XSS
A st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in the Calendar feature of REDCap through 14.9.6 allows authenticated users to inject malicious scripts into the Notes field of a calendar event. When the event is viewed, the crafted payload is executed, potentially enabling the execution of arbitrary web scripts.

What is the severity of CVE-2024-56313?
The severity of CVE-2024-56313 is high due to its potential to allow authenticated users to execute malicious scripts via stored cross-site scripting.
How do I fix CVE-2024-56313?
To fix CVE-2024-56313, upgrade to a version of REDCap that is newer than 14.9.6 where the vulnerability is patched.
Who is affected by CVE-2024-56313?
Authenticated users of REDCap versions up to and including 14.9.6 can be affected by CVE-2024-56313.
What is the impact of CVE-2024-56313?
The impact of CVE-2024-56313 allows attackers to inject and execute malicious scripts in the Notes field of calendar events, potentially leading to data compromise.
Is user input validated in CVE-2024-56313?
In the case of CVE-2024-56313, user input in the Notes field is not adequately validated, allowing for the injection of scripts.
